最简洁的方法是为表单设置ID或类,并使用CSS设置表单的宽度和高度.在你看来:
<% form_for ..., :html => { :class => "myform" } do |f| %>
...
<% end %>
Run Code Online (Sandbox Code Playgroud)
在以下位置设置表单的宽度和高度public/stylesheets/application.css:
form.myform {
width: 75%;
height: 500px;
/* Or fill in whatever width and height values you need */
}
Run Code Online (Sandbox Code Playgroud)
最后,确保application.css样式表包含在HTML布局中.你app/views/layouts/application.html.erb应该包含这样的一行:
<%= stylesheet_link_tag "application" %>
Run Code Online (Sandbox Code Playgroud)
最后一点:注意为表单设置特定高度.如果表单的内容不符合指定的高度,您的表单可能看起来不像预期的那样.你可以通过overflow: scroll在宽度和高度声明之后设置样式表来防止这种情况,但在大多数情况下,你可能最好让表单占据它所需的高度.
| 归档时间: |
|
| 查看次数: |
2875 次 |
| 最近记录: |